Dharampur
Dharampur is a village located in Bighapur tehsil of Unnao district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Bighapur (tehsildar office) and 60km away from district headquarter Unnao. As per 2009 stats, Dulikhera is the gram panchayat of Dharampur village.

About Dharampur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dharampur is 142957. The village spans a total geographical area of 537.02 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 229501. Unnao is nearest town to Dharampur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 60km away.

Population of Dharampur
Below is a concise population overview of Dharampur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 381 | 201 | 180 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 64 | 31 | 33 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 247 | 129 | 118 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 127 | 86 | 41 |
Illiterate Population | 254 | 115 | 139 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dharampur village:
- The total population of Dharampur village is around 381, including approximately 201 males and 180 females, with a sex ratio of 895 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 64 children aged 0–6 years in Dharampur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Dharampur village has 247 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Dharampur village is about 33.33%, with male literacy at 42.79% and female literacy at 22.78%.
- There are around 68 households in Dharampur village.
Connectivity of Dharampur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dharampur. As per the 2011 stats, Dharampur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
